Konstantin Pribluda commented on XDP-211:
-----------------------------------------

if you look at dtd under URL you will surely see that:

<!ELEMENT class (
 	meta*,
	subselect?,
	cache?,
	synchronize*,
	comment?,
    tuplizer*,
	(id|composite-id),
	discriminator?,
	natural-id?,
	(version|timestamp)?,
	(property|many-to-one|one-to-one|component|dynamic-component|properties|any|map|set|list|bag|idbag|array|primitive-array)*,
	((join*,subclass*)|joined-subclass*|union-subclass*),
	loader?,sql-insert?,sql-update?,sql-delete?,
	filter*,
    resultset*,
	(query|sql-query)*
)>


so please blame Gavin & Those folks at RedHat who change DTD wiuthout notice.... 
I just try to keep up with them.    You may also want to upgrade  HB to 3.2.1.ga which 
is source-compatible ( up to query names, which are  qualified with class name now )

> I am using a @hibernate.query tag and the mapping task generates an invalid XXX.hdm.xml whith
> <hibernate-mapping>
>   <class ...>
>     ......
>       <query .../>
>   </class>
> when I try to create a hibernate sessionfactory I get:  the following exception 
>   org.xml.sax.SAXParseException: Element "class" does not allow "query" here.
